dc.description | The Davao City Agriculturist’s Office (Cagro), through its Fishery Resources Management Services Division, has advised fisherfolk to refrain from going out to sea due to the threat posed by Tropical Depression Crising. Aimee C. Evora, senior aquaculturist and acting head of the Fishery Resources Management Services Division of Cagro, said that although the city is not directly in the path of the tropical depression, fishermen should avoid venturing out to sea and must ensure their boats are securely tied. | en |
